A  Flybe  Embraer 195 aircraft heading to London Gatwick from Cornwall Airport Newquay at 07:35 BST on Tuesday 24th  April 2018, was forced to turn back after a crack covering the windscreen in the cockpit appeared.

The plane was carrying 92 passengers and was at 12, 000 ft (3, 750m) at the time. Passenger Ray Ellis who was  going to a business meeting in London said: “ The plane slowed down a bit, then they made an announcement that there was a crack in the windscreen and they had to return to Newquay.” Road transport to Gatwick was arranged for the passengers.
